Procedures have been devised for the isolation of the surface membranes of mouse fibroblasts (L cell) and a variety of other cells. The surface membranes are stabilized by various reagents in a hypotonic solution and are then removed intact or as large fragments with a Dounce homogenizer. The membranes are purified by differential centrifugation on solutions of sucrose or glycerol or on a column of fine glass beads. A trilaminar pattern can be seen in thin sections of the membrane in the electron microscope. Sufficient material can be conveniently obtained for chemical analyses.
